Introduction to Grow Tent Warming
Grow tents are enclosed spaces designed to provide plants with the perfect environment for growth. These tents are equipped with various features such as lighting, ventilation, and sometimes heating and cooling systems. The temperature inside a grow tent is a critical factor that can significantly impact plant health and productivity. Most plants thrive in temperatures ranging from 65°F to 75°F (18°C to 24°C), but this can vary depending on the plant species and growth stage.

Methods for Warming Up Your Grow Tent
Fortunately, there are several methods you can use to warm up your grow tent, each with its own advantages and disadvantages.
Using Heating Mats or Pads
One of the most effective methods for warming up a grow tent is by using heating mats or pads. These are placed under the soil and provide a constant, gentle heat that promotes root growth. They are especially useful for seedlings and cuttings, which are more sensitive to temperature fluctuations.
Installing a Space Heater
Another option is to install a space heater within your grow tent. These heaters can quickly warm up the air and are available in various sizes and types, including electric, gas, and infrared models. However, it’s essential to choose a heater that is designed for indoor use and to follow all safety precautions to avoid fires or burns.
Utilizing Passive Heating Methods
For those on a budget or looking for a more eco-friendly solution, there are several passive heating methods that can be used. For example, insulating the grow tent can help retain heat and reduce heat loss. Additionally, using thermal mass, such as concrete or brick, can absorb heat during the day and release it at night, providing a stable temperature.
Thermal Mass Calculation
To determine the right amount of thermal mass for your grow tent, you’ll need to calculate the volume of the space and the desired temperature increase. A general rule of thumb is to use 1-2 pounds of thermal mass per cubic foot of grow space.

What is the ideal temperature for a grow tent?
The ideal temperature for a grow tent varies depending on the type of plants being grown, as well as the stage of growth. Generally, most plants prefer daytime temperatures between 68-77°F (20-25°C) and nighttime temperatures 5-10°F (3-6°C) lower. However, some plants such as orchids and African violets require warmer temperatures, while others like lettuce and spinach prefer cooler temperatures. It’s essential to research the specific temperature requirements for your plants to ensure optimal growth and health.
Maintaining a consistent temperature is crucial, as fluctuations can stress plants and lead to disease or pest issues. To achieve this, you can use thermometers, thermostats, and heating or cooling systems specifically designed for grow tents. These tools help monitor and regulate the temperature, ensuring it remains within the ideal range for your plants. What is the importance of humidity control in a grow tent?
Humidity control is crucial in a grow tent, as it plays a significant role in plant growth and health. Most plants prefer a relative humidity of 40-60%, although some plants such as orchids and ferns require higher humidity levels. If the humidity is too low, plants may become stressed and susceptible to disease, while high humidity can lead to fungal growth and root rot. Additionally, humidity affects the plant’s ability to absorb nutrients and water, making it essential to maintain optimal humidity levels.
To control humidity in your grow tent, you can use a hygrometer to monitor the humidity levels and adjust as needed. There are several ways to increase or decrease humidity, including using humidifiers or dehumidifiers, misting the plants, or improving air circulation. Can I use a thermometer to monitor temperature in my grow tent?
Yes, a thermometer is an essential tool for monitoring temperature in your grow tent. There are several types of thermometers available, including digital thermometers, analog thermometers, and temperature probes. Digital thermometers are a popular choice, as they provide accurate and precise temperature readings. When choosing a thermometer, consider the accuracy, response time, and durability, as well as any additional features such as temperature alarms or data logging.
It’s essential to place the thermometer in a location where it can provide an accurate reading of the temperature in the grow tent. This is usually near the canopy of the plants, away from heating or cooling sources, and in a spot where air circulation is good.
